#161a10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#161a10 is composed of 8.6% red, 10.2%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.5% yellow and 89.8% black. It has a hue angle of 84 degrees, a saturation of 23.8% and a lightness of 8.2%. #161a10 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c3420 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#161a10 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#161a10 has RGB values of R:22, G:26,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.9. Its decimal value is 1448464.
